Ferris Sweep Keymap

The keymap images below are exported from keymap-drawer, and the latest keymap can also be viewed there.

The source code for this keymap is available at nxtkb/zmk-config-4-ferris-sweep, which provides the complete configuration for the NXTKB Ferris Sweep keyboard.

  • The default layer is where you type characters.
  • CTRL, OPTION (ALT), and COMMAND (WINDOWS) share the home-row character keys under your ring, middle, and index fingers. Hold the key for the modifier, or tap it for the character.

default layer

  • Hold the right TAB layer key to enter the numbers and navigation layer.
  • Release the right TAB key to return to the default layer.
  • Special keys:
    • Boot: make the right half of the split keyboard enter bootloader mode so you can copy new firmware to it.

numbers and navigation layer

  • Hold the left TAB layer key to enter the symbols layer.
  • Release the left TAB key to return to the default layer.
  • Special keys:
    • Report: type out battery information.
    • Boot: make the left half of the split keyboard enter bootloader mode so you can copy new firmware to it.
    • MOUSE: switch to the mouse layer.

symbols layer

  • Hold both TAB layer keys to enter the function layer.
    • BT 0 to BT 4: select the Bluetooth profile you are connecting or want to connect with.
    • BT CLR: clear the connection for the selected profile, then reconnect that profile with your device.
    • OUT TOG: toggle between USB and Bluetooth output, so you can connect up to 6 devices: 5 over Bluetooth and 1 over USB.
    • CODEX: press I to enter the Codex layer. This requires Codex Micro-enabled firmware.
    • Studio: unlock the keyboard so you can use ZMK Studio to set up keys.
    • Off: enter soft-off mode. This is similar to deep sleep, but the keyboard can only wake from the configured wake key, currently the left thumb LSHIFT key.
  • Release the TAB layer keys to return to the default layer.

func layer

  • Hold the left TAB layer key and press SPACE to toggle the mouse layer.
  • Press P or Q to leave the mouse layer.
  • MB4 is browser back and MB5 is browser forward.

mouse layer

  • Hold both TAB layer keys to open the function layer, then press I to toggle the Codex layer.
  • QY select Agents 1–6.
  • A, S, D, and F are Approve, Split chat, Decline, and Fast.
  • H starts Voice input and J sends the current input.
  • Press P to leave the Codex layer and restore normal typing.
  • Ferris Sweep has no display, so check Agent status in the ChatGPT desktop app. All control keys still work normally.
